The Wörlitzer See is a lake in Saxony-Anhalt ( Germany ).
The Wörlitzer See, which is located immediately north of the city of Wörlitz ( Wittenberg district ), is only a few meters deep on average and is 59 m above sea level. NN . The lake is drained via the Elbe in a northerly direction into the North Sea.
The lake is an oxbow lake of the Elbe. It has a major impact on the Wörlitz Park , which was included in the UNESCO World Heritage List in 2000 .
The lake is located in the Middle Elbe Biosphere Reserve .
